We've all heard the story about Jonah and the whale. But have we all explored the idea that the story of Jonah may have been a literary story to teach us an important lesson? Pastors Wyatt Martin and Steve Brooks talk about what it means to read the Bible literarily versus literally. Regardless of where you land on this debate, the book of Jonah is undeniably part of God's living word for us.
For a portion of this episode, Wyatt and Steve reference the passage where Jesus talks about Jonah the prophet. This passage can be found in Matthew 12, but Wyatt mistakenly quotes it as Luke 12.
